“The Praise of Stupidity” can be called “an international super-bestseller of the Renaissance”, because immediately after the first publication in Paris in 1511, it went through 7 reprints in France alone, and in total was reprinted in different countries during the author’s lifetime more than 40 times. Erasmus himself, who considered his satire, brilliant in form and content, to be nothing more than an amusing literary trifle, was quite surprised by such a resounding success. In the work constructed in the form of a monologue, the main character is Moriya (Stupidity), revealing her secrets to the reader, listing her merits, praising herself and, most importantly, mocking many "wise men". In discussions about its purpose, it touches on issues of art, culture, social structure, and many others.
